Popular Toyota Camry 2000 Modifications

The Toyota Camry 2000 has a vast array of modifications that you can install. Below are some of the most popular modifications that car enthusiasts love:

1. Air Intake and Exhaust System

Installing an aftermarket air intake and exhaust system can significantly improve your Camry's performance. A high-performance air intake system increases the amount of air entering the engine, while a performance exhaust system increases the amount of exhaust gases exiting the engine. These upgrades can increase your Camry's horsepower, torque, and fuel efficiency.

2. Suspension Upgrades

Upgrading your Camry's suspension can improve its handling, stability, and comfort. Installing coilovers, sway bars, and strut braces can reduce body roll and improve cornering. Suspension upgrades can also give your Camry a lowered or raised stance, depending on your preference.

3. Body Kit

Adding a body kit to your Camry can transform its appearance and give it a sportier and aggressive look. A body kit includes front and rear bumpers, side skirts, and a rear spoiler. You can choose from various designs and materials, such as carbon fiber, fiberglass, or polyurethane.
